The key is to have enough available outlets. Read the boxes of lights and do not attach more strings together than recommended. Then sketch out a design and execute it. There are lots of lighting ideas here on Hometalk.

Solar string lights vary considerably in quality. The degree of light brightness they give off after dark is dependent on the length of time that which the sensor is exposed to direct sunlight during the daytime.
